Job Description
Diagnose, treat, and help prevent allergic diseases and disease processes affecting the immune system.

Tasks for “Physician”
- Present research findings at national meetings or in peer-reviewed journals.
 - Document patients' medical histories.
 - Diagnose or treat allergic or immunologic conditions.
 - Provide allergy or immunology consultation or education to physicians or other health care providers.
 - Order or perform diagnostic tests such as skin pricks and intradermal, patch, or delayed hypersensitivity tests.
 - Perform allergen provocation tests such as nasal, conjunctival, bronchial, oral, food, and medication challenges.
 - Assess the risks and benefits of therapies for allergic and immunologic disorders.
 - Prescribe medication such as antihistamines, antibiotics, and nasal, oral, topical, or inhaled glucocorticosteroids.
 - Develop individualized treatment plans for patients, considering patient preferences, clinical data, or the risks and benefits of therapies.
 - Conduct laboratory or clinical research on allergy or immunology topics.
 - Educate patients about diagnoses, prognoses, or treatments.
 - Coordinate the care of patients with other health care professionals or support staff.
 - Interpret diagnostic test results to make appropriate differential diagnoses.
 - Conduct physical examinations of patients.
 - Provide therapies, such as allergen immunotherapy and immunoglobin therapy, to treat immune conditions.
 - Engage in self-directed learning and continuing education activities.
